What Causes Coolant Leaks from the Engine Block?

Coolant leaks from the engine block can occur due to several reasons. Here are the most common culprits:

Cracks in the Engine Block

Over time, engine blocks can develop cracks due to thermal stress, manufacturing defects, or even corrosion. These cracks can allow coolant to escape, leading to low coolant levels and overheating.

Head Gasket Failure

The head gasket sits between the engine block and the cylinder head. If this gasket fails, it can cause coolant to leak into the engine or out of the block. This is often accompanied by other symptoms like white smoke from the exhaust or milky oil.

Corrosion

Corrosion can eat away at the metal of the engine block, leading to pinhole leaks. This is more common in older vehicles or those that have been poorly maintained. Regular coolant changes can help mitigate this issue.

Improper Installation of Components

If the engine has been rebuilt or components have been replaced, improper installation can lead to leaks. This includes issues with seals, gaskets, or even the bolts that hold the engine together.

Signs of a Coolant Leak

Identifying a coolant leak early can save you a lot of trouble down the line. Here are some signs to watch for:

  • Low Coolant Levels: If you find yourself frequently topping off the coolant, there’s a leak somewhere.
  • Overheating Engine: A leaking coolant system can lead to overheating, which is a recipe for disaster.
  • Visible Puddles: Look for puddles of coolant under your vehicle. Coolant is usually green, orange, or pink, depending on the type.
  • Steam or Smoke: If you see steam coming from under the hood, it could be coolant leaking onto hot engine parts.

Diagnosing the Problem

If you suspect a coolant leak from the engine block, it’s crucial to diagnose the problem accurately. Here’s how you can do it:

  1. Visual Inspection: Start with a thorough visual inspection of the engine block and surrounding areas.
  2. Pressure Test: A pressure test can help identify leaks that aren’t immediately visible.
  3. Check Oil Condition: Look for signs of coolant mixing with oil, which can indicate a head gasket failure.
  4. Temperature Monitoring: Use a temperature gauge to monitor engine temperatures during operation.

Repair Options

Once you’ve diagnosed the issue, it’s time to consider repair options. Depending on the severity of the leak, you may have several choices:

Sealants

For minor leaks, a coolant sealant can sometimes do the trick. These products are designed to seal small cracks and leaks but are not a permanent solution.

Gasket Replacement

If the head gasket is the problem, replacing it is often the best course of action. This is a labor-intensive job, but it’s crucial for the health of your engine.

Engine Block Repair

In cases of severe cracks, you may need to consider professional welding or even replacing the engine block entirely. This is an expensive option but may be necessary for older vehicles.
